Transaction 5930206a19e358d7c873a1e6fdeecd0daebb9239b3dfb0e0ef7dcc2c90e81cdc
1 Input
1 Output
-
5930206a19e358d7c873a1e6fdeecd0daebb9239b3dfb0e0ef7dcc2c90e81cdc:0
- value
- 618674
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 577d55ef8ca645fcd73a399e54c184c3df3f4efa OP_EQUAL
- address
- 39fcri5tfMFbRG7rPHkWkzZWgvkF4FP1F3